摘 要:目的建立同时测定人体尿中12种羟基多环芳烃的液相色谱串联质谱(liquid chromatography-tandemmass spectrometry,LC-MS-MS)分析法。方法尿液经过酶解、固相萃取法纯化、富集以及浓缩,然后采用液相色谱串联质谱检测尿中12种(2-羟基萘、1-羟基萘、3-羟基芴、2-羟基芴、2-羟基菲、1-羟基菲、1-羟基芘、3-羟基、6-羟基、1-羟基苯并[a]蒽、9-羟基苯并[a]芘和3-羟基苯并[a]芘)多环芳烃代谢物。结果在0.002~177 ng/ml的线性范围内,所得回归方程线性关系良好,均r≥0.99。该方法的检出限为0.002~0.03 ng/ml,平均回收率为77.4%~132.1%,RSD为1.5%~11.8%。结论该方法灵敏度和精密度均较高,回收率和重复性良好,适用于人尿中12种羟基多环芳烃的同时检测。Objective To develop a method for simultaneous determination of twelve metabolites of polycyclic aromatic hydrocarbons(OH-PAHs) in human urine(2-hydroxynaphthalene,1-hydroxynaphthalene,3-hydoxyfluorene,2-hydoxyfluorene,2-hydroxyphenanthrene,1-hydroxyphenanthrene,1-hydroxypyrene,3-hydroxychrysene,6-hydroxychrysene,1-hydoxybenz [a] anthracene,9-hydoxybenz[a]pyrene and 3-hydoxybenz[a]pyrene) by liquid chromatography-tandem mass spectrometry(LC-MS-MS) method.M ethods The samples were hydrolyzed by enzyme first,then were purified and enriched by solid phase extraction,concentrated and determined with LC-MS-MS.Results The regression equations showed a good linearity in the range of 0.002-177 ng/ml and the correlation coefficients were not less than 0.99.The limits of detection of the method were between 0.002-0.03 ng/ml.The recovery rates were 77.4%-132.1% and the relative standard deviations were 1.5%-11.8%.Conclusion The established method is sensitive,reproducible with higher precision and better recoveries,and it is applicable to simultaneous determination of twelve metabolites of polycyclic aromatic hydrocarbons in human urine.
